## Template rendering performance — contacts

Welcome aboard. Rendering performance for the Quillstone template engine is owned by the Pagecraft team. Before filing anything, run the built-in profiler and attach the trace; tickets without traces get bounced. Cache-layer questions go to Pagecraft too, not infrastructure. For anything urgent, such as render times regressing past the 200ms budget, contact the performance rotation at the address below.

billing contact of kahap-tawef = gorys@lumicio.internal

Facilities Ticket #— Canteen shared door, Thornwick Building

New starters: our canteen connects to the premises of Aldermere Consulting next door. The connecting door must stay shut outside lunch hours. Do not hold it open for anyone without a visible badge from either firm. To return to our side after 14:00, use the keypad with the code below.

staff pass of kawip-hawef = bdg-QLP-2

MEMO — Kettling Depot Receiving

Uniform sets for the new Kettling depot arrive Wednesday via Ashgrove courier: 40 boxes, sorted by size, manifest attached to box one. Check the count at the dock before signing; shortages go straight to stores, not the courier. The hand-over instruction the courier will follow is set out below.

drop instructions, tafof-baguf: the holmir gilox courier leaves the sormir ulaok holdor ledger at gate 5596 under passcode 257343

Starting with the Marwick payroll cycle, exports move from fixed-width to delimited format. Before running the export, confirm the Ledgerline schema version is 4 or higher, and verify the Hollis staging bucket is empty. The converter job, Spoolfish, must authenticate against the internal Paystream validation service, and it requires the key shown below.

service key, yadug-bajog: zpat3_pou

## Deploying the Gatewick Proctor Queue

Deploys are pretty painless: push to main, wait for the pipeline, then watch the queue drain dashboard for five minutes. If candidates pile up mid-exam, roll back first and ask questions later — the queue replays safely. Everything the workers care about lives in one config block, shown here for reference.

settings of bafof-yagef:
JOROX_PIN=8740
JOROX_TENANT=pelox
JOROX_METRICS_HOST=metrics.jorox.qorvelworks.internal
JOROX_SEAL=seal_c78f63c1
JOROX_STANDBY_TEAM=norax